As writers, we are always told to write what we know. But what if you want to write about characters who are nothing like you? Characters that have magical powers or characters who lived in the 1700s. Or maybe you want to write about a character who is a brain surgeon or an astronaut, and you are a secretary or a teacher. How do we make those characters sound authentic when they are nothing like us? This workshop is designed to give you the tools to not only write what you know more effectively but to also write what you don’t know in a way that readers would never pick up on this fact.
